Clarence Daniels

OTTUMWA - Clarence M. "Pete" Daniels, 83, of 912 E. Williams St. died at 10:04 a.m. Sept. 9, 1993, at Ottumwa Regional Health Center.

He was born Sept. 7, 1910, in Ottumwa to John and Edna Mabel Tanner Daniels. He married Virginia Deal on Nov. 11, 1933.

A resident of Ottumwa most of his life, he started in the tire business in 1935 with Smith The Tire Man, which he later owned. He was an employee for Pangborn Tire, managed General Tire and was shop foreman for Black's Tire, retiring in 1977. He was a member of Wesley United Methodist Church and Ottumwa Regional Health Center Auxiliary.

He is survived by his wife; two daughters, Pat Black of Ottumwa and Carla Heaton of Bloomfield Route 3; five grandchildren; two great-granddaughters; and two sisters, Alice Brown and Margaret Morrow of Douds.

He was preceded in death by a daughter, Carolyn Joann Danield; three sisters, Edith Renes, Mabel Higdon and Elizabeth Daniels; and two brothers, John and Art Daniels.

The service will be 1:30 p.m. Saturday at Wesley United Methodist Church, the Rev. Richard Quinlan officiating. Burial will be in Memorial Lawn Cemetery in Ottumwa.

Visitation is open after 10 a.m. today at Reece Funeral Home in Ottumwa. Family visitation will be from 7 to 8:30p.m.

Pallbearers will be Tom and Travis Black, Gary Jr. and Gregory Heaton, Mike Hendren and Danny Boos.

Memorials may be made to Wesley United Methodists Church.
